7个解锁网页媒体资源的实战技巧:从入门到精通的媒体嗅探工具指南
在数字化时代,网页中的视频、音频等媒体资源已成为信息传递的重要载体。然而,这些资源往往被加密或隐藏在复杂的网络请求中,普通用户难以直接获取。媒体嗅探工具(能够自动检测并提取网页中媒体资源的专业工具)的出现,为内容创作者、教育工作者和研究人员提供了高效解决方案。本文将带您深入探索这一工具的核心价值,从基础安装到高级应用,全面掌握网页资源提取技术。
一、认知:揭开媒体嗅探工具的神秘面纱
媒体嗅探工具(又称网页资源提取器)通过监控浏览器网络请求,识别并解析出网页中加载的各类媒体文件,包括视频、音频、图片等。与传统下载方式相比,它具有三大核心优势:自动识别多种媒体格式、支持加密内容解密、提供批量处理功能。这些特性使其在在线教育资源保存、媒体素材采集等场景中发挥着不可替代的作用。
技术原理简析
当网页加载媒体内容时,会通过HTTP/HTTPS协议发送请求。媒体嗅探工具通过拦截这些请求,分析响应头信息(如Content-Type字段)和文件特征,识别出媒体资源的真实URL。对于采用HLS(HTTP Live Streaming,一种基于HTTP的流媒体传输协议)等高级协议的内容,工具还能解析其分片文件并重组为完整媒体。
二、安装:多平台部署与基础配置
主流浏览器安装指南
🔍 Chrome/Edge用户:访问Chrome网上应用店,搜索"猫抓"扩展程序,点击"添加至Chrome"完成安装。安装后浏览器工具栏会出现猫抓图标,点击即可打开主界面。
💡 Firefox用户:需从扩展官网下载XPI文件,在浏览器地址栏输入"about:addons",点击"从文件安装"并选择下载的XPI文件。安装完成后需重启浏览器生效。
个性化设置指南
首次使用前,建议进入设置界面完成以下配置:
- 资源过滤规则:在"高级设置"中开启"智能筛选",可按文件大小(如仅显示大于10MB的视频)、格式类型(如排除广告视频)进行过滤
- 下载路径设置:在"下载管理"中指定默认保存目录,并勾选"按日期创建子文件夹",避免文件混乱
- 快捷键配置:在"快捷键"选项卡中设置"快速嗅探"热键(如Alt+Shift+C),提高操作效率
猫抓扩展主界面
三、场景:三大核心应用领域深度探索
1. 在线教育资源留存
当浏览在线课程平台时,猫抓会自动检测页面中的视频资源。在工具界面中,您可以看到每个视频的详细信息:文件大小、时长、分辨率等。对于系列课程,可通过"批量选择"功能一次性下载所有课时,配合"自动命名"功能(设置格式为"课程名称-第X讲"),轻松构建个人学习资源库。
2. HLS流媒体解析实战
面对采用HLS协议的加密视频(常见于直播回放、付费内容),需使用专门的M3U8解析功能: 🔍 在猫抓主界面点击"流媒体解析"按钮,粘贴M3U8文件地址 💡 如遇加密内容,在"解密设置"中上传密钥文件或输入Base64密钥 ⚠️ 注意:部分网站对分片文件做了时效限制,建议解析后立即开始下载
M3U8流媒体解析界面
3. 批量资源采集方案
内容创作者常需收集大量素材,猫抓的批量处理功能可显著提升效率:
- 多页面资源汇总:通过"其他页面"标签页切换不同标签页的资源列表,统一管理
- 定时任务设置:在"高级功能"中设置"定时嗅探",自动抓取周期性更新的媒体资源
- 格式转换选项:勾选"自动转MP4",将FLV、WebM等格式统一转换为通用格式
四、优化:提升效率的专业技巧
下载性能优化
- 线程数调节:根据网络状况调整下载线程(建议设置为8-16线程),在"下载设置"中拖动滑块即可
- 断点续传启用:勾选"支持断点续传"选项,避免网络中断导致重下
- 代理配置:在"网络设置"中添加代理服务器,解决部分地区资源访问限制
跨浏览器兼容性处理
不同浏览器对扩展API的支持存在差异,建议:
- Chrome/Edge:支持全部高级功能,包括WebRTC监控和MQTT协议解析
- Firefox:部分功能受限,如"媒体控制"需在扩展设置中手动开启权限
- Safari:需通过Tampermonkey脚本间接使用核心功能,具体方法可参考官方文档
五、问题:常见挑战与解决方案
资源嗅探失败
若工具未检测到预期资源,可按以下步骤排查:
- 刷新目标网页并重新打开猫抓(部分动态加载资源需二次触发)
- 检查"设置-高级"中的"请求拦截范围",确保已勾选"所有请求"
- 尝试"强制嗅探"功能(快捷键Ctrl+Shift+R),强制重新扫描网络请求
格式兼容性问题
遇到无法播放的下载文件时: 💡 使用工具内置的"格式修复"功能(在文件右键菜单中) ⚠️ 对于特殊编码的文件,建议配合FFmpeg工具进行转码,猫抓提供"发送到FFmpeg"快捷选项
下载速度优化
当下载速度过慢时:
- 减少同时下载的文件数量(建议不超过5个)
- 在"高级设置"中启用"智能限速",避免因带宽占用过高导致连接中断
- 检查存储设备读写速度,更换SSD可显著提升大文件写入速度
通过本文介绍的方法,您已掌握媒体嗅探工具的核心使用技巧。无论是个人学习资料整理,还是专业内容创作,这款工具都能成为您高效提取网页资源的得力助手。记住,技术本身是中性的,请始终遵守相关法律法规,尊重内容创作者的知识产权,合理使用所获取的媒体资源。随着网络技术的不断发展,媒体嗅探工具也将持续进化,为用户提供更强大、更智能的资源提取解决方案。
atomcodeClaude Code 的开源替代方案。连接任意大模型,编辑代码,运行命令,自动验证 — 全自动执行。用 Rust 构建,极致性能。 | An open-source alternative to Claude Code. Connect any LLM, edit code, run commands, and verify changes — autonomously. Built in Rust for speed. Get StartedRust099- DDeepSeek-V4-ProDeepSeek-V4-Pro(总参数 1.6 万亿,激活 49B)面向复杂推理和高级编程任务,在代码竞赛、数学推理、Agent 工作流等场景表现优异,性能接近国际前沿闭源模型。Python00
MiMo-V2.5-ProMiMo-V2.5-Pro作为旗舰模型,擅⻓处理复杂Agent任务,单次任务可完成近千次⼯具调⽤与⼗余轮上 下⽂压缩。Python00
GLM-5.1GLM-5.1是智谱迄今最智能的旗舰模型,也是目前全球最强的开源模型。GLM-5.1大大提高了代码能力,在完成长程任务方面提升尤为显著。和此前分钟级交互的模型不同,它能够在一次任务中独立、持续工作超过8小时,期间自主规划、执行、自我进化,最终交付完整的工程级成果。Jinja00
Kimi-K2.6Kimi K2.6 是一款开源的原生多模态智能体模型,在长程编码、编码驱动设计、主动自主执行以及群体任务编排等实用能力方面实现了显著提升。Python00
MiniMax-M2.7MiniMax-M2.7 是我们首个深度参与自身进化过程的模型。M2.7 具备构建复杂智能体应用框架的能力,能够借助智能体团队、复杂技能以及动态工具搜索,完成高度精细的生产力任务。Python00